Tidak jarang proyek yang Anda kerjakan membutuhkan banyak tugas atau aktivitas yang perlu diselesaikan. Anda pun merasa khawatir apabila ada tugas atau pekerjaan yang terlewatkan dalam suatu proyek. Untuk mengatasi masalah tersebut, Anda memerlukan backlog. Backlog adalah alat yang berguna untuk membantu Project Manager (PM) maupun anggota timnya dalam memantau setiap pekerjaan dari proyek yang sedang dijalankan.
Daftar Isi
ToggleApa Itu Backlog?
Apakah yang dimaksud dengan backlog itu? Mengapa orang yang terlibat dalam pengerjaan proyek harus menggunakan backlog? Mari kita lihat penjelasannya di bawah ini.
Definisi Backlog
Pada dasarnya, backlog adalah daftar tugas, pekerjaan, atau aktivitas yang harus diselesaikan dalam suatu proyek. Daftar ini berisi segala hal yang diperlukan untuk mencapai tujuan akhir dari sebuah proyek. Umumnya, backlog digambarkan dalam bentuk catatan digital yang terus diperbarui seiring perkembangan proyek.
Sebagai seorang PM, Anda pasti menyadari bahwa backlog dibutuhkan untuk merencanakan, mengorganisasi, dan mengelola sumber daya secara efektif. Penggunaan backlog pun dapat membantu tim proyek agar lebih fokus pada tugas-tugas yang paling penting dan mendesak.
Karakteristik Backlog yang Benar
Backlog yang baik harus memenuhi beberapa karakteristik kunci agar tetap efektif dalam manajemen proyek. Berikut adalah beberapa di antaranya:
1. Detailed Appropriately
Backlog harus menyediakan informasi yang cukup untuk menggambarkan tugas secara jelas dan komprehensif. Deskripsi tugas, tujuan, dan kriteria keberhasilan harus ditentukan dengan tepat agar tidak menimbulkan kebingungan di antara anggota tim.
2. Estimated
Setiap tugas dalam backlog harus memiliki batasan durasi waktu yang diperlukan untuk menyelesaikannya. Estimasi ini membantu dalam perencanaan waktu dan manajemen ekspektasi.
3. Emergent
Seiring perkembangan proyek, beberapa tugas mungkin memerlukan perubahan seperti penambahan atau dihapus dari backlog. Backlog yang baik harus bisa menerima perubahan secara fleksibel.
4. Prioritized
Prioritas harus jelas diberikan pada setiap tugas dalam backlog. Anggota tim bisa mengetahui tugas yang perlu diselesaikan lebih dahulu dan tugas yang dapat ditunda.
Baca Juga: Lakukan Backup Website Anda Menggunakan Tools Ini
Tujuan dan Manfaat Backlog dalam Manajemen Proyek
Backlog memiliki sejumlah tujuan dan manfaat yang berarti dalam manajemen proyek. Berikut adalah beberapa di antaranya:
1. Mengidentifikasi Prioritas
Dalam backlog, tugas-tugas disusun berdasarkan tingkat prioritas. Anda dan anggota tim proyek bisa mengetahui lebih jelas tentang tugas yang harus diselesaikan terlebih dahulu dan memerlukan perhatian lebih.
2. Meningkatkan Transparansi
Backlog memberikan wawasan secara menyeluruh mengenai proyek, termasuk progres saat ini dan rencana masa depan. Semua orang dalam tim bisa melihat dan memahami bagaimana proyek berjalan.
3. Menghadapi Perubahan
Proyek sering kali mengalami perubahan sesuai dengan kondisi yang terjadi. Perubahan ini bisa diakomodasi dengan backlog sehingga tidak mengganggu jalannya proyek.
4. Peningkatan Kolaborasi
Backlog melibatkan seluruh tim dalam perencanaan dan pengambilan keputusan. Secara tidak langsung, backlog bermanfaat dalam menciptakan atmosfer kolaboratif yang positif dan mendorong keterlibatan semua anggota tim.
5. Efisiensi dalam Penggunaan Sumber Daya
Project Manager bisa mengalokasikan sumber daya dengan lebih efisien, baik waktu, tenaga, maupun uang dengan mengetahui prioritas tugas yang harus dikerjakan. Tujuan ini tentunya berdampak pada pengurangan pemborosan sumber daya.
Penggunaan Backlog dalam Manajemen Proyek
Sekarang, mari kita lihat bagaimana backlog digunakan dalam manajemen proyek untuk mengoptimalkan jalannya sebuah proyek.
1. Identifikasi Skala Prioritas Tugas
Berkat adanya backlog, Anda bisa mengidentifikasi tugas-tugas yang memerlukan perhatian mendesak. Prioritas tugas akan membantu tim lebih fokus pada pekerjaan yang benar-benar penting untuk mencapai target proyek.
2. Pemantauan dan Penyelesaian Tugas
Dalam backlog, Anda bisa melacak kemajuan setiap tugas. Anda pun bisa memantau kinerja tim dan mengambil tindakan segera jika ada tugas yang terbengkalai.
3. Perencanaan Rencana Tindak Lanjut
Setelah tugas selesai, backlog juga dapat digunakan untuk merencanakan langkah-langkah tindak lanjut atau aktivitas selanjutnya. Alhasil, proyek tetap bergerak maju dengan efisien dengan merencanakan tindak lanjut menggunakan backlog.
4. Membantu Tim Fokus
Tim yang terlibat dalam sebuah proyek bisa lebih fokus pada pekerjaan yang telah direncanakan sebelumnya jika menggunakan backlog. Mereka pun bisa menghindari gangguan yang tidak perlu serta meningkatkan produktivitas.
5. Meningkatkan Komunikasi
Backlog berfungsi sebagai sumber informasi bagi seluruh anggota tim. Mereka bisa lebih mudah berkomunikasi tentang tugas-tugas yang harus diselesaikan dan mendiskusikan perkembangan proyek secara terbuka.
Baca Juga: 5 Skill untuk Menjadi Backend Developer Andal
Urutan Cara Mengelola Backlog
Saat menggunakan backlog, ada beberapa langkah penting yang harus diikuti untuk mengelolanya dengan baik. Berikut adalah urutan pengelolaan backlog:
1. Menyusun Daftar Tugas
Pertama, Anda perlu menyusun daftar semua tugas yang diperlukan untuk menyelesaikan proyek. Pastikan deskripsi tugas ditulis dengan cukup jelas dan estimasi waktu telah ditetapkan berdasarkan prioritas yang ada.
2. Mengatur Prioritas Tugas
Setelah daftar tugas tersusun, langkah selanjutnya adalah mengatur prioritasnya. Identifikasi tugas-tugas yang krusial dan tentukan urutan penyelesaiannya agar anggota tim bisa lebih fokus dalam mengerjakan pekerjaannya.
3. Mengelompokkan Tugas
Tugas yang saling berkaitan sebaiknya dikelompokkan bersama. Tips ini membantu dalam perencanaan serta melihat gambaran besar dari proyek yang sedang dikerjakan.
Tips Mengelola Backlog yang Efektif
Backlog yang dikelola dengan baik merupakan kunci awal yang memengaruhi kelancaran suatu proyek. Lantas, bagaimana sebaiknya backlog dikelola? Ikuti beberapa tips di bawah ini!
1. Buat Batasan Waktu dalam Setiap Tugas
Tetapkan batasan waktu yang realistis untuk menyelesaikan setiap tugas dalam backlog supaya anggota tim akan merasa lebih terdorong untuk bekerja lebih produktif. Batasan waktu juga membantu mencegah agar tugas-tugas tertentu tidak terlalu lama tertunda pengerjaannya, sehingga proyek tetap berjalan sesuai jadwal.
Pastikan untuk mengomunikasikan batasan waktu ini dengan jelas kepada seluruh anggota tim. Langkah ini berguna dalam mencegah kebingungan dan memastikan setiap orang memiliki pemahaman yang sama tentang tenggat waktu yang harus diikuti.
2. Review Backlog secara Berkala
Lakukan review rutin terhadap backlog dengan melibatkan seluruh tim proyek. Tentukan jadwal untuk melakukan review, contohnya setiap minggu atau setiap bulan, tergantung pada kompleksitas dan durasi proyek. Review berkala memastikan bahwa backlog selalu up-to-date dan mencerminkan perubahan terbaru dalam proyek.
Selama sesi review, seluruh tim dapat berdiskusi tentang perkembangan proyek, progres tugas-tugas di dalam backlog, serta mengidentifikasi masalah atau hambatan yang mungkin muncul. Anda pun bisa mengumpulkan masukan berharga dan mengambil keputusan bersama untuk mengoptimalkan jalannya proyek.
3. Batasi Ukuran Backlog
Walaupun backlog digunakan untuk mengelola tugas-tugas proyek, Anda harus tetap menjaga agar backlog tidak terlalu besar dan rumit. Jika backlog terlalu besar, risiko anggota tim kehilangan fokus dan keterlambatan proyek akan meningkat.
Pertahankan jumlah tugas dalam backlog agar tetap terkelola dengan baik. Prioritaskan tugas yang paling krusial dan segera penting serta pertimbangkan untuk menyimpan tugas-tugas lain dalam daftar perencanaan jangka panjang atau cadangan. Anggota tim pun tetap berfokus pada tugas-tugas yang paling relevan dan mendesak.
4. Terapkan Metode Agile
Metode agile adalah pendekatan fleksibel dalam manajemen proyek yang berfokus pada kolaborasi tim dan adaptasi cepat terhadap perubahan. Dalam metode agile, backlog sering kali dikelola dalam bentuk sprint atau iterasi yang mengharuskan tim bekerja pada sejumlah tugas yang telah diprioritaskan selama periode waktu tertentu. Setelah sprint selesai, dilakukan review hasil kerja tim dan melakukan adaptasi jika diperlukan.
Penerapan metode agile dapat membantu anggota tim beradaptasi lebih cepat dengan perubahan kebutuhan proyek. Metode agile juga bermanfaat dalam meningkatkan transparansi, dan memberdayakan anggota tim untuk lebih proaktif dalam mengatasi tantangan yang muncul.
5. Buang Tugas yang Tidak Diperlukan
Dalam pengelolaan backlog, Anda perlu meneliti tugas yang sudah tidak relevan atau tidak diperlukan lagi. Evaluasi secara periodik jika beberapa tugas tertentu masih relevan dalam mencapai tujuan proyek.
Apabila ada, jangan ragu untuk menghapusnya dari backlog. Backlog tetap bersih dari tugas yang tidak lagi memberikan nilai tambah bagi proyek sehingga tim tetap fokus pada tugas yang lebih krusial.
6. Libatkan Anggota Tim dalam Pembuatan Backlog
Keterlibatan seluruh anggota tim sangat penting dalam menyusun backlog. Dalam perencanaan awal, libatkan tim untuk mengidentifikasi dan menentukan tugas-tugas yang diperlukan untuk mencapai tujuan proyek. Langkah ini membantu Anda dalam mengumpulkan wawasan yang beragam dan memastikan bahwa seluruh aspek proyek terakomodasi dalam backlog.
Baca Juga: Backend Programming: Definisi, Lingkup, dan Skill yang Diperlukan
7. Terbuka Terhadap Ide dan Masukan Baru
Terakhir, tetaplah terbuka terhadap ide dan masukan baru dari anggota tim sebagai kunci untuk menciptakan backlog yang baik dan efektif. Jadilah pendengar yang baik dan dengarkan setiap ide atau masukan yang diterima. Langkah ini berguna supaya Anda bisa menciptakan backlog yang lebih komprehensif dan mencerminkan kebutuhan sebenarnya dari sebuah proyek yang sedang berjalan.
Kini, Anda tidak perlu kewalahan lagi dalam mengerjakan sebuah proyek karena ada backlog. Backlog adalah daftar tugas yang disusun sesuai dengan skala prioritas supaya Anda dan anggota tim lainnya bisa lebih fokus dalam menyelesaikan sebuah proyek atau pekerjaan yang sedang dilakukan di perusahaan.
Terkadang ada beberapa proyek atau pekerjaan non-operasional di perusahaan Anda yang memerlukan kerja sama dengan perusahaan lainnya, seperti Digital Marketing. Digital Marketing membutuhkan strategi dan tools tertentu agar tujuan pemasaran perusahaan Anda bisa dicapai dengan maksimal. Maka dari itu, mari bekerja sama dengan ToffeeDev, Digital Marketing Agency Indonesia untuk menyukseskan kampanye pemasaran digital Anda! Klik di sini untuk berkonsultasi mengenai tujuan pemasaran yang ingin Anda capai bersama ToffeeDev!